International recognition caps great week for young midfielder

There was double end of season joy for Egli Kaja after he received an international call-up just days after featuring for the first-team against Oldham.

The 19-year-old midfielder, (pictured above left with Alfie Egan) has been invited to an Albania Under-21 training camp at Durres between 14-18 May.

Dons academy product Egli, who moved to England with his family at the age of three, is very proud to be recognised by his country and he attended the Euro 2016 Finals to cheer on Albania last year.

“My parents decided to leave Albania to give me a better life, but I have never forgotten my roots,” said Egli. “It is massive for me to get a call-up and it would mean so much to represent Albania. I only found out on Wednesday and it was quite random. I had spoken to the Under-21s head coach Alban Bushi a couple of months ago, but then it went a bit quiet.

“It was unexpected to get the call-up, but I am excited and I cannot wait to go really. It has been a great week or so for me. I felt I had a good game for the Under-21s last Thursday and then on Saturday I was given positive news about my future at the club. I had been waiting all season to make a first-team appearance and it was great to come on against Oldham. To be called-up for the Albania Under-21s was the icing on the cake.”

Egli was born in Prelez, Kosovo, but people from that country are eligible to play for Albania and his parents and grandparents were born in Albania.

 All at AFC Wimbledon wish Egli every success in his pursuit of international honours.
